Output d2ef98996a71408e506f6d26c0bea01e8a17100dccc859da67720bb18fcceb7d:0

value
184873158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ef59aa234ebf8a2b082b1ed580acef59f2600bd OP_EQUAL
address
34WiRAbuNxznAS46kbvq5cFqU8UYvDVKPN
transaction
d2ef98996a71408e506f6d26c0bea01e8a17100dccc859da67720bb18fcceb7d
confirmations
469426
spent
true